In a clear referendum against Donald Trump, Canadians went to the polls and chose the Liberal Party candidate, Mark Carney over Conservative Party candidate, Pierre Poilievre. Despite 10 years of economic stagnation under Justin Trudeau and the Liberal Party, voters chose to double down on the same failed policies.
